    JOB SUMMARY

    • CANDIDATE MUST BE US Citizen (due to contractual/access requirements)*

    Highmark Health is seeking a highly experienced and technically adept Cybersecurity Engineer with a deep specialization in Vulnerability Management and Secure Configuration Management. This pivotal role is responsible for the strategic development, implementation, and continuous enhancement of enterprise-wide security controls and practices that proactively defend against evolving threats and meet critical business and regulatory obligations.

    As a lead Security Engineer, you will leverage your 10+ years of expertise to design, develop, and implement robust ISRM Infrastructure solutions, ensuring optimal performance, resilience, and security across diverse environments, including cloud security and infrastructure security. You will champion security baselines and configuration management practices for on-premises, endpoint, network, application, and containerized systems.

    A key aspect of this role involves researching, analyzing and recommending cutting-edge security technologies, threat detection capabilities, and attack surface management solutions. You will be instrumental in driving the adoption of automation, orchestration, and advanced analytics to improve vulnerability management effectiveness, enhance threat visibility, and streamline remediation efforts. Strong scripting skills and experience with system integrations are essential to succeed in this role.

    This position requires a U.S. Citizen due to contractual and access requirements. If you are a proactive and innovative cybersecurity professional passionate about building and securing critical infrastructure, we encourage you to apply.

    Highmark provides millions of people with the security of quality health insurance

    Our history of helping families and companies with their health insurance needs dates to the 1930s, when our predecessor companies were established to help Pennsylvania's residents pay for health care.

    Highmark was created in 1996 by the consolidation of two Pennsylvania licensees of the Blue Cross and Blue Shield Association — Pennsylvania Blue Shield (now Highmark Blue Shield) and Blue Cross of Western Pennsylvania (now Highmark Blue Cross Blue Shield). We are now one of the largest health insurers in the United States.
